Objective data sheet Rev. 2 — 30 October 2020 55 / 98 13.14 SENS_CONFIG4 register (address 18h) Table 54. SENS_CONFIG4 register (address 18h) bit allocation Bit 7 6 5 4 3 2 1 0 Name EXT_ TRIG_M WAKE_ SDCD_WT WAKE_ SDCD_OT WAKE_ ORIENT DRDY_PUL INT2_FUNC INT_ PP_OD INT_POL Reset 0 0 0 0 0 0 0 1 Access R/W R/W R/W R/W R/W R/W R/W R/W Table 55. SENS_CONFIG4 register (address 18h) bit description Field Description 7 EXT_TRIG_M External trigger function acquisition mode. 0 (default): Each positive going trigger edge causes a single ADC acquisition to be made. When the number of acquisitions specified by the current operating mode decimation setting have been triggered, the final decimated output is stored in the OUT_X/Y/Z registers or the buffer depending on the setting made in BUF_CONFIG1[BUF_MODE[1:0]]. . 1: Each positive going trigger edge causes the number of acquisitions specified by the current operating mode decimation setting to be automatically made (only one trigger event is needed to acquire all of the measurements specified by the decimation setting). Once the specified number of acquisitions have been made, the final decimated output is stored in the OUT_X/Y/Z registers or the buffer depending on the setting made in BUF_CONFIG1[BUF_MODE[1:0]]. Notes: • The EXT_TRIG_M setting only applies when INT2_FUNC = 1. • The SRC_DRDY event flag is asserted after the specified number of measurements have completed and the final decimated output result is available. Note that the SRC_DRDY flag is only asserted when BUF_CONFIG1[BUF_MODE[1:0]] = 00b • In LPM, this bit has no effect as the decimation factor is fixed at 1. 6 WAKE_SDCD_WT SDCD within thresholds event Auto-WAKE/SLEEP transition source enable 0 (default): SDCD within thresholds event is not used to prevent entry into/trigger an exit from SLEEP mode. 1: SDCD within thresholds event is used to prevent entry into/trigger an exit from SLEEP mode. 5 WAKE_SDCD_OT SDCD outside of thresholds event Auto-WAKE/SLEEP transition source enable 0 (default): SDCD outside of thresholds event is not used to prevent entry into/trigger an exit from SLEEP mode. 1: SDCD outside of thresholds event is used to prevent entry into/trigger an exit from SLEEP mode. 4 WAKE_ORIENT Orientation change event Auto-WAKE/SLEEP transition source enable 0 (default): Orientation change condition is not used as an event to prevent entry into /trigger an exit from SLEEP mode. 1: Orientation change condition is used as an event to prevent entry into/trigger an exit from SLEEP mode. 3 DRDY_PUL Pulse generation option for DRDY event 0 (default): A SRC_DRDY event is output on the INTx pin as an active high or active low signal depending on the polarity setting made in INT_POL. The INTx pin will remain asserted until the host reads any of the OUT_X/Y/Z registers. 1: A 32 μs (nominal) duration pulse is output on the configured INTx pin once per ODR cycle. The output pulse is either positive or negative, depending on the INT_POL setting. Note: The pulsed output signal is OR'd with all of the other interrupt events assigned to the INTx pin. Note: In Motion Detection mode (BT_MODE = VDD), the state of this bit is ignored and has no effect on device operation. |
